AMD could be developing a 32GB RDNA 4 GPU: possible RTX 5090 rival or enterprise only?

Rumor mill: Rumors have surfaced claiming that AMD is developing an RDNA 4 GPU with up to 32GB of VRAM. It sounds like an exciting prospect, potentially leading to a card that could compete with the monstrous RTX 5090. Unfortunately for gamers, it would likely be an enterprise product designed for data centers and professional applications.
improvement: The leaker now states the card will be the RX 9070 XT 32GB, priced much higher than the standard version, and will launch at the end of the second quarter. It will be primarily designed for AI, but it's still a gaming card and not a Radeon Pro.
This rumor, like many others, comes from Chiphell, the Chinese tech-focused forum, so take it with a grain of salt. It states that AMD will launch a high-end RDNA 4 GPU sometime in the first half of 2025. The amount of VRAM it will feature has yet to be decided, but it could be as high as 32GB – the same amount as Nvidia's RTX 5090.
While a rival to the RTX 5090 from Team Red sounds like something the industry and gamers would welcome, it seems almost certain that the rumored GPU will be used as an enterprise product, which requires extra memory. The Radeon Pro W7900, for example, comes with 48GB of GDDR6, while the Instinct MI300X has 192GB of HBM3.
The other thing to remember is that AMD presented last year that it would not be competing with Nvidia when it comes to the current generation of flagship gaming cards. It confirmed that releasing cards in the Radeon RX 9000 series to match Nvidia's top RTX 5000 GPU won't be a priority. Instead, Team Red will be focusing on its mid-range and lower-end products to increase the business's overall market share.
AMD unveiled the Radeon RX 9070 XT and Radeon RX 9070 GPUs at CES last month. The business did not reveal any details beyond stating that the RDNA 4 architecture is built on TSMC's 4nm node while featuring optimized compute units, improved ray tracing per CU, 'supercharged' AI compute, and advanced media encoding quality.
There were reports only a few hours ago that claimed AMD is set to seriously undercut Nvidia's mid-range cards with its Radeon RX 9000 series. The RX 9070 XT could arrive with a $599 MSRP, $150 less than the $749 RTX 5070 Ti, while the RX 9070 is expected to be priced below the $549 RTX 5070.
